Mustonenfest. Hope
Participants:
Mario Brunello, cello
Iris Oja, mezzo-soprano
Siret Sui, flute
Sinfonietta Rīga
Chamber Choir of the Estonian Philharmony
Conductor Andres Mustonen
Programme:
Valentin Silvestrov „Prayer for Ukraine“, “Music of Silence”
Leonard Bernstein Halil, for flute and chamber orchestra
William Byrd Ave verum corpus
Johann Sebastian Bach Mass in B minor, BWV 232 (Gloria, Agnus Dei)
Joseph Haydn Cello Concerto in C major, Hob.VIIb:1
The festival’s grandiose symphony concert is an emotional journey around the world in which faith and love stand side-by-side with desperation, but always also alongside hope. Andres Mustonen brings to the audience a range of high-level international performers and a colourful and diverse programme.
Ideological content and spiritual message are prioritised in all my programmes and right now Ukraine is in our hearts and our prayers.
/Andres Mustonen/
